Potato, savoy cabbage and mushroom casserole

Ingredients

- 4 Rooster potatoes
- 1 Onion chopped
- 12 Button mushrooms
- ¼ Savoy cabbage
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t, Pepper
- ½ tablespoon tomato paste
- 1 Lemon
- 100ml water
Method
- Peel and cube the potatoes then simmer in salted water for 5 minutes, then drain.
- Heat up the oil in a casserole dish then fry the potatoes for 2-3 minutes.
- Add the onions, followed by the mushrooms. Stirring to avoid sticking.
- Add the finely shredded cabbage.
- Once soft add the tomato paste diluted in the water and ¼ of lemon zest.
- Season and cover with a little greaseproof paper, simmer for a further 15 minutes until everything is cooked.
